Responsibilities
  • Directs the operation of a state veterans center in providing long term health care and quality medical services to eligible veterans; develops goals, operation plans and work programs; evaluates compliance.

  • Serves as the federal fiduciary for incompetent patients and, as such, not only manages patient’s money but determines needs of patient and acts on their behalf in financial matters.

  • Plans and directs patient care programs, support services, volunteer programs, risk management activities, public and community relations efforts and various training activities; develops budget work programs, determines staffing requirements, approves various personnel actions and reviews program activities and expenditures to ensure compliance with budgetary and FTE limits and other requirements.

  • Coordinates program requirements and operations with other state and federal agencies; negotiates agreements and contracts for goods and services as appropriate; reviews or approves purchases using General Services Administration, Veterans Administration or other federal supply contracts.

  • Participates in meetings and planning sessions with local, state and federal agencies involving the evaluation and development of agency policies, procedures and regulations; makes recommendations for changes; serves on special committees as required; interprets and administers state and federal guidelines concerning center operations and activities.

  • Reviews inquiries, complaints, problems or other information concerning the operation of the center; formulates or directs the preparation of appropriate responses or other action; answers inquiries referred by the Executive Director; resolves emergency or unusual incidents or problems as needed while on twenty four hour call.

Level Descriptor

At this level incumbents are assigned overall responsibility for directing and coordinating the operations and activities of one of the State Veterans Homes.

Education and Experience

Education and Experience requirements at this level consist of a bachelor’s degree in business or public administration, public health or hospital administration or closely related field and four years of professional level experience in a managerial or administrative capacity in a health or nursing care facility or over a program providing services for veterans or military personnel; or an equivalent combination of education and experience substituting one year of professional level experience in a managerial or administrative capacity in a health or nursing care facility or over a program providing services for veterans or military personnel for each year of required education, plus certification as a Licensed Nursing Home Administrator.

Knowledge,

Skills, Abilities and Competencies

Knowledge,

Skills and Abilities

required at this level include knowledge of state and federal laws and regulations concerning various veterans benefits and services; of requirements for eligibility for admission to a long-term care facility; of procedures for determining allowable maintenance charges and collecting benefits from the Veterans Administration; of licensing and registration requirements for physicians, nurses, therapists and other professionals; of personnel administration and of supervisory principles and practices.

Ability is required to direct the work of others; to administer the operations of a long-term health facility; to communicate effectively; and to establish and maintain effective working relationships with others.

Special Requirements

Will be subject to on call duty on a twenty-four-hour basis.
